Locality: FATU HIVA: Ridge south of Amoa village, leading from coast southeast towards Tefatutea peak. Elevation 5-320 m. Steep rocky slopes: lower parts with secondary shrubland of Eugenia uniflora, Psidium guajava, Morinda citrifolia, Walth....

PLDesc: Twining vine with woody stems, corolla dull purple. Naturalized at 100 m and below. Seeds red and black.
